Kenneth Ray Jacobs' Obituary
Kenneth Ray Jacobs, 91, of Michigan Center, passed away, September 29, 2024, at Henry Ford Hospice home. Kenneth’s family and friends will gather from 10:00 a.m. -11:00 a.m., Thursday, October 3, 2024, with his funeral service immediately following. Carl Rice Jr. (son-in-law) will officiate.
He was born on November 27, 1932, in Michigan Center, Michigan to Ray and Elsie (Van Tuyl) Jacobs. After attending Michigan Center Schools, Kenneth was drafted into the United States Army and proudly served his country during the Korean Conflict. On April 26, 1955, he married the love of his life, Marge Arlene (Jewel) Jacobs and enjoyed many years together until her passing. He will be remembered as a dedicated employee with Kelsey-Hayes for 30 years. He loved working on lawn mowers and cars, hunting, going to the casinos and enjoyed going out to eat.
Kenneth will be missed by his children, Timothy (Angie) Jacobs and Penny (Carl) Rice; grandchildren Jeff (Amy) Miller, BJ Rice, Christy (Chris) Sechler, Nathan (Peri) Jacobs; great grandchildren Alana Miller, Brayden Miller, Camden Sechler, and Caroline Sechler. He is preceded in death by his parents, Ray and Elsie Jacobs; siblings, Victor Jacobs, Ariwin Jacobs, Dwight Jacobs, Manley Jacobs, Merlin Jacobs, Delelah Sager, Emajoy Gyurkovitz; daughter, Shari Betz; grandchildren, Ryan Rice, Joey Miller; and great grandchild, Chad Miller.
